Farmers have often viewed dingoes as the enemy, waging war against them to protect their livestock.
Killing dingoes costs millions of dollars each year, but it hasn't resolved the conflict.
As some farmers are discovering, there are unexpected benefits of learning to coexist with dingoes instead.
Living alongside dingoes could help us make some of the fundamental changes needed to stop the loss of biodiversity.
But to make this happen, we will have to shift our attitude towards dingoes, gain support from grazers and other stakeholders, and make non-lethal coexistence tools and approaches the new standard practice. Provided by The Conversation.
